Subject: Invoice renderer cut-over done

Hi,

We finished moving the Copperbell PDF invoice renderer to the new worker pool yesterday evening. Rendering now happens asynchronously; the old synchronous endpoint is gone. Throughput looks good and error rates are back to baseline after a brief spike during DNS propagation. Templates were carried over unchanged, so output should be byte-identical. If you need to debug locally, mirror the production setup, which uses the values below.

service settings:
[casax]
port = 6379
team = rusir
host = casax.zemvarhq.corp
region = outer-4
access_code = ac_9808ce
timeout_ms = 1500

Subject: Renewal of the Corvelli Metals supply contract

Our three-year agreement with Corvelli Metals expires at the end of next quarter. Procurement has assessed two alternatives, but neither matches Corvelli's delivery reliability or tolerances on the Helgrin alloy. We therefore recommend renewal with a revised volume schedule and a 4% price cap per annum. Legal has reviewed the draft terms and flagged no material risks. Please send objections within five working days. The commercial reasoning behind this timing is set out below.

confidential, kagup-bafog: Fraaxax Group is in early talks to buy Soroxox Group for about $343.8 million. The Olidor launch date is June 14, and nothing goes to the press before then. Legal wants the Aldmirek Logistics term sheet signed before July 23.

Finance Review Summary — Q2 Cash-Flow Forecast

Pellam Industries, heads of department. Operating inflows tracking 6% below plan; receivables slippage at the Garrowby division is the main driver. Outflows steady. Contingency line intact. Forecast assumes the Trellick contract pays on schedule; if not, expect a tightening in month two. No external borrowing anticipated. The plan underpinning these assumptions is set out below.

confidential, bagep-bagag: The renewal with Druathax Group closes at $10 million a year, 10 percent below the last contract. Project Zorael slips by a full year because of the staffing delay.